

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

# Visualizar sessões do Amazon DCV
<a name="managing-sessions-lifecycle-view"></a>

O administrador em um servidor Amazon DCV do Windows ou o usuário-raiz em um servidor Amazon DCV do Linux pode visualizar todas as sessões ativas em execução no servidor. Os usuários do Amazon DCV só podem visualizar as sessões que eles mesmos criaram.



**Topics**
+ [Visualizar todas as sessões ativas](#list-all)
+ [Visualizar uma sessão ativa específica](#view-specific)

## Visualizar todas as sessões ativas
<a name="list-all"></a>

Para listar as sessões ativas virtuais ou de console em um servidor Amazon DCV do Windows ou Linux, use o comando `dcv list-sessions`.

**Topics**
+ [Sintaxe](#list-all-syntax)
+ [Output](#output)

### Sintaxe
<a name="list-all-syntax"></a>

```
dcv list-sessions
```

### Output
<a name="output"></a>

O comando retorna uma lista de sessões ativas no seguinte formato.

```
Session: session-id (owner:session-owner type:virtual|console name:'my session')
```

## Visualizar uma sessão ativa específica
<a name="view-specific"></a>

Para visualizar informações sobre uma sessão, use o comando `dcv describe-session` e especifique a ID exclusiva da sessão.

**Topics**
+ [Sintaxe](#view-specific-syntax)
+ [Output](#output)

### Sintaxe
<a name="view-specific-syntax"></a>

```
$ dcv describe-session session_id
```

### Output
<a name="output"></a>

Na saída de exemplo a seguir, o elemento `display-layout` indica que o layout de exibição da sessão está definido para usar duas telas de 800 x 600. Delas, a segunda tela é deslocada x = 800 (à direita) da primeira tela.

```
Session: test
  owner: session-id
  name: session-name
  x display: :1
  x authority: /run/user/1009/dcv/test.xauth
  display layout: 800x600+0+0,800x600+800+0
```

Também é possível incluir a opção `--json` (ou `-j`) para forçar o comando a retornar a saída no formato JSON. A saída JSON fornece detalhes adicionais sobre a sessão. 

```
$ dcv describe-session session-id --json
```

Veja a seguir um exemplo de saída JSON.

```
{
  "id" : "session-id",
  "owner" : "dcvuser",
  "name" : "session-name",
  "num-of-connections" : 0,
  "creation-time" : "2020-03-02T16:08:50Z",
  "last-disconnection-time" : "",
  "licenses" : [
    {
      "product" : "dcv",
      "status" : "licensed",
      "check-timestamp" : "2020-03-02T16:08:50Z",
      "expiration-date" : "2020-03-29T00:00:00Z"
    },
    {
      "product" : "dcv-gl",
      "status" : "licensed",
      "check-timestamp" : "2020-03-02T16:08:50Z",
      "expiration-date" : "2020-03-29T00:00:00Z"
    }
  ],
  "storage-root" : "",
  "type" : "virtual",
  "x11-display" : ":2",
  "x11-authority" : "/run/user/1009/dcv/vsession.xauth",
  "display-layout" : [
    {
      "width" : 800,
      "height" : 600,
      "x" : 0,
      "y" : 0
    },
    {
      "width" : 800,
      "height" : 600,
      "x" : 800,
      "y" : 0
    }
  ]
}
```